    Dr. Thomas is a Physiatrist near Charlotte, NC. Physical medicine and rehabilitation, or rehabilitation medicine, specializes in diagnosing and treating physical disabilities from musculoskeletal issues and neurological conditions. Such diseases are often caused from health issues affecting the musculoskeletal system such as neck and back pain, sports injuries, or other painful conditions affecting the limbs, such as carpal tunnel syndrome. A physiatrist aims to restore physical, psychological, social, and vocational function through comprehensive rehabilitation and pain management. They may use techniques like electromyography for diagnosis and have expertise in therapeutic exercise, prosthetics, and orthotics. Pain management is one of the key focus area of the physiatrist.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
